
Volume 1 Detroit territory 1969-74
By Brad McFarlin
Edited by Greg Oliver
Brad McFarlin, a lifetime wrestling fan and resident of the Detroit area, has opened up his photographic archives, giving readers a rare glimpse into the Big Time Wrestling promotion run by The Sheik.
Volume 1 features photos from 1969 to 1974.
Besides the blood and fire of The Sheik, there’s a look into competing promotions, wrestlers away from the ring, rookies on the rise (like a very young Randy Savage), women, little people, bears! Oh my!
And there’s a short history of the Detroit territory during this time period by celebrated author Brian S. Solomon.
Curated and edited by Greg Oliver, The Lens of Brad McFarlin: Volume 1 Detroit territory 1969-74 is a treat for wrestling fans!
ABOUT THE AUTHOR/PHOTOGRAPHER
Beginning at a young age, Brad McFarlin had an eye for a camera. As he contributed to countless wrestling magazines, he befriended many wrestlers like Ron Dupree and morphed into manager “Handsome” Johnny Bradford.
